Travel Score in 01223, Becket, Massachusetts

The Travel Score for the Asthma Score in 01223, Becket, Massachusetts is 49 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

49.84 percent of residents in 01223 to travel to work in 30 minutes or less.

When looking at the three closest hospitals, the average distance to a hospital is 17.69 miles. The closest hospital with an emergency room is Berkshire Medical Center with a distance of 9.56 miles from the area.

## Breathing Easy in Becket: Navigating Healthcare in ZIP Code 01223

The crisp mountain air of Becket, Massachusetts (ZIP Code 01223), often beckons those seeking respite from urban clamor. But for individuals managing asthma, the allure of this tranquil setting must be carefully weighed against the practicalities of healthcare access. A move to Becket, while potentially beneficial for respiratory health due to cleaner air, necessitates a thorough understanding of transportation options to ensure timely medical care. This write-up serves as an 'Asthma Score' assessment, evaluating the ease of accessing healthcare from 01223, considering the unique challenges faced by those with respiratory conditions.

The cornerstone of any asthma management plan is readily available medical attention. In Becket, this translates to understanding the distance and accessibility of healthcare facilities. The nearest primary care physicians and specialists are primarily located in the neighboring towns of Lee, Lenox, and Pittsfield. These locations offer comprehensive medical services, including pulmonologists, allergists, and emergency care facilities essential for managing asthma exacerbations.

The primary mode of transportation in this region is personal vehicle. Driving times, therefore, become a critical factor. From the heart of Becket, a drive to Lee, home to Fairview Hospital, typically takes around 15-20 minutes via Route 20. Lenox, also offering medical services, is a similar distance, reachable primarily via Route 7. Pittsfield, the regional hub with a wider array of specialists and Berkshire Medical Center, requires a drive of approximately 30-45 minutes, primarily utilizing Route 20 and the Massachusetts Turnpike (I-90). These drive times, while manageable, can be significantly impacted by weather conditions, particularly during winter months when snow and ice can impede travel.

Public transportation options in the Berkshires are limited. The Berkshire Regional Transit Authority (BRTA) provides bus services, but routes within Becket and connecting to healthcare facilities are infrequent. Route B1, serving the Pittsfield area, might offer some limited connectivity, but its schedule and stops are not designed for frequent medical appointments. The lack of robust public transit presents a significant challenge for individuals who cannot drive or prefer not to. The absence of ADA-accessible features on all routes, particularly for those with mobility limitations often associated with severe asthma, further complicates matters. This reliance on personal vehicles, or the need for alternative transportation, is a key consideration when assessing healthcare access.

Ride-sharing services, such as Uber and Lyft, are available in the Berkshires, but their reliability and availability can vary. While they offer a potential solution for transportation, particularly for urgent appointments or when personal vehicles are unavailable, their cost can be a significant factor. Furthermore, the wait times for ride-sharing services in a rural area like Becket can be longer than in more urban centers, potentially delaying access to critical medical care during an asthma emergency.

Medical transport services offer a specialized solution for individuals with specific needs. These services, often provided by ambulance companies or private medical transport providers, are designed to transport patients to and from medical appointments, including those with mobility limitations. Brands like AMR (American Medical Response) and local ambulance services operate in the region. While these services provide a crucial safety net, they are typically reserved for individuals with significant medical needs or those requiring stretcher transport, and the cost can be substantial.

The 'Asthma Score' for healthcare access in 01223 must also consider the broader context of asthma management. Proximity to pharmacies for medication refills is crucial. Pharmacies are available in Lee, Lenox, and Pittsfield, necessitating a drive to access essential medications. The availability of urgent care facilities, essential for managing asthma exacerbations, is also a factor. Fairview Hospital in Lee and Berkshire Medical Center in Pittsfield offer emergency services, providing a safety net for those experiencing severe asthma symptoms.
